Quick Setup Guide
The EM250 DRO Setup parameters allow you to configure your DRO for the encoders fitted
to you machine. You only need to do this the once as the settings will be retained by the
DRO. You can edit them at anytime, should a need arise, by re-entering Setup. All parameters
must be entered in METRIC.

Display shows: "DIAL INC"
Function:
This function is used on 2-axes Mill DRO's by the Inclined machining and Arc
contouring functions to simulate a Z-axis input by calibrating the DRO to the
resolution and turns of the Knee axis dial.
Operation: Press the
The message display will show "ENTR PPM"
Enter the distance moved by the Z-axis for one Z-axis dial increment
You can either take this straight off the dial or for a more accurate result use a dial gauge from the spindle to
measure the true physical movement.
